Unix系统深度学习环境搭建与包管理精简指南
|
在Unix系统上搭建深度学习环境,首先需要选择合适的操作系统。常见的选择包括Ubuntu、CentOS和Fedora等,其中Ubuntu因其活跃的社区和丰富的软件包支持,成为许多开发者的首选。 安装完成后,建议更新系统软件包以确保安全性与兼容性。使用命令`sudo apt update && sudo apt upgrade`可以完成这一操作,这有助于避免后续安装过程中出现依赖冲突。 接下来是Python环境的配置。大多数深度学习框架依赖于Python 3,因此需确认系统中已安装Python 3,并可通过`python3 --version`进行验证。推荐使用`pyenv`或`conda`来管理多个Python版本,以适应不同项目的需求。
AI绘图结果,仅供参考 对于深度学习框架,如TensorFlow和PyTorch,推荐通过pip或conda进行安装。例如,`pip install tensorflow`或`conda install pytorch torchvision torchaudio -c pytorch`。这些命令会自动处理依赖关系,简化安装流程。GPU支持是提升深度学习性能的关键。需安装NVIDIA驱动和CUDA工具包,具体步骤可参考NVIDIA官方文档。同时,确保安装的深度学习框架版本与CUDA版本兼容。 包管理方面,除了pip和conda,还可以使用`apt`或`dnf`管理系统级依赖。合理利用虚拟环境(如`venv`或`virtualenv`)可以避免全局环境的混乱,提高项目的可移植性和稳定性。 定期清理无用的包和缓存,有助于保持系统的整洁与高效。使用`pip cache purge`或`apt autoremove`等命令可以实现这一点。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

